Facebook and Politics with Crystal Patterson of FSB Public Affairs
Crystal Patterson joins The Great Battlefield podcast to talk about her career in politics, working at Facebook's political arm, working on the internet presence of Ted Kennedy and Hillary Clinton, and her current role at FSB Public Affairs.

Politics on Social Media with Katie Harbath of Anchor Change, formerly of Facebook
Katie Harbath joins The Great Battlefield podcast to talk about running Public Policy at Facebook after joining them from the NRSC, starting Anchor Change and how she's working to solve the problems in the intersection of technology and democracy.

How the DCCC Helped the Democrats Take Back The House, with Dan Sena
Dan Sena, the outgoing Executive Director of the Democratic Congressional Campaign Committee, joins The Great Battlefield podcast to discuss how under his leadership the DCCC helped the Democratic Party retake the US House of Representatives in the 2018 Midterms.

Winning in the Midterms, and Laying the Groundwork for 2020 with Priorities USA's Guy Cecil
Guy Cecil joins The Great Battlefield podcast to discuss his work as Chairman of Priorities USA, a key progressive super PAC founded in 2011 to support Barack Obama's re-election. He tells us how Priorities has altered their digital strategy since the election of Trump, their approach to supporting candidates in the midterms, and how they are laying the groundwork for 2020.
